County approves advisory-board appointments, a clerk overlap payment and names Tanya Hurley human services administrator

Franklin County Commissioners · April 30, 2026

Summary

Franklin County commissioners appointed two advisory-board members, approved $7,400 to fund a 60‑day clerk overlap ahead of a retirement, and confirmed Tanya Hurley as human services administrator with phased pay steps effective April 23.

At the meeting the board approved several personnel actions: two advisory-board appointments, a temporary overlap payment to the Clerk of Court for training, and a promotion and phased-salary plan for an internal Human Services Administrator candidate.
